Output 84ced267cd7e5024facafa048bfa833e537dc3c2b7f3aa56ca00c7bfedae6020:46

value
29298
script pubkey
OP_0 OP_PUSHBYTES_20 1fddbc060643e4b5976be7668e569fb40463ca5a
address
bc1qrlwmcpsxg0jtt9mtuangu45lkszx8jj6als3z2
transaction
84ced267cd7e5024facafa048bfa833e537dc3c2b7f3aa56ca00c7bfedae6020
spent
true